テクノロジーの進歩は、目覚ましいものがあります。
特に、人工知能(AI)の発展が著しいです。
これにより、ソフトウェア開発の分野が大きな変革期を迎えています。
最近、ある出来事がありました。
大手クラウドサービス企業の幹部が、社内会議で興味深い内容を語ったのです。
その内容が、開発の未来に関する重要な示唆を含んでいました。
1. AIによるコーディング作業の自動化
この幹部は、近い将来について言及しました。
多くの開発者が、コーディング作業から解放される可能性があるというのです。
具体的には、今後2年程度の期間を指しています。
その間に、従来のプログラミング作業の大部分がAIによって自動化されるかもしれません。
しかし、これは開発者の仕事がなくなるということではありません。
むしろ、開発者の役割が進化するということです。
より創造的で戦略的な業務にシフトしていくのです。
2. 開発者の役割の変化
今後、開発者に求められるスキルセットが大きく変わると予想されています。
具体的には、以下のような能力が重要になるでしょう。
- 顧客ニーズの深い理解
- 革新的なソリューションの設計
- エンドユーザー体験の向上
つまり、開発者の役割が変わるのです。
単なるコード作成者から、ビジネス課題を解決するイノベーターへと進化することが求められています。
3. AIツールの活用
この変化に対応するため、多くの企業が動き出しています。
AIツールの導入を進めているのです。
例えば、ある企業では興味深い取り組みを行っています。
社内のコミュニケーションツールにAIチャットボットを統合したのです。
これにより、従業員の質問に自動で回答するシステムを構築しました。
4. 業界全体の見方
この見解は、当該企業の幹部だけのものではありません。
他の大手テクノロジー企業のCEOたちも、同様の意見を述べています。
AIによるプログラミングの民主化や、開発者の役割の変化について言及しているのです。
5. 今後の展望
AIの進化により、ソフトウェア開発の世界は大きく変わっていくでしょう。
しかし、これは脅威ではありません。
むしろ、機会として捉えるべきです。
なぜなら、開発者はAIツールを活用できるからです。
そして、より高度な問題解決やイノベーションに注力できるようになるのです。
6. 企業の対応
多くの企業が、この変化に対応するための取り組みを始めています。
例えば、以下のような施策を行っています。
- 従業員のAIリテラシー向上のための研修プログラムの実施
- AIを活用した新しい開発プロセスの導入
- 顧客ニーズを深く理解するためのデータ分析能力の強化
まとめ
AIの進化は、ソフトウェア開発の世界に大きな変革をもたらしています。
開発者の役割は、大きく変わるでしょう。
コードを書くことから、より戦略的で創造的な業務へとシフトしていくのです。
この変化に適応することが重要です。
そして、新しいスキルを身につけることも大切です。
これらが、今後の開発者にとって不可欠となるでしょう。
企業は、この変化を前向きに捉えるべきです。
AIツールを効果的に活用し、イノベーションを加速させる機会として活用すべきでしょう。
ソフトウェア開発の未来は、明るいものがあります。
人間とAIの協調にあるのです。
この新しい時代に、私たちはどう向き合っていくべきでしょうか。
考えるべき時が来ています。